Award-winning Denver bar coming to Columbus–for a limited time
A popular Columbus bar is joining forces with one of its Rocky Mountain counterparts for one night only.
Last week, the two concepts announced that Denver bar Semiprecious is planning a takeover of the lauded Brewery District spot Cobra on April 19.

Semiprecious, which is located in the Denver neighborhood of Sunnyside, is billed as “the Denver outpost of the international award-winning team behind Thunderbolt in LA.” It was recently named one of ten best new cocktail bars in the Western division of the Tales of the Cocktail Foundation’s Spirited Awards as well as one of the top 50 bars in Denver by Denver Westwood.
